Although there are a number of mutual funds available, most are stock funds, bond funds, money market funds or goal date funds.

Create a budget: Based on your financial evaluation, choose how much money you'll be able to comfortably invest in stocks. You also need to know if you're starting with a lump sum or smaller amounts put in more than time. Your budget should ensure that You're not dipping into funds you need for expenses.

Mutual funds are purchased through a broker or fund manager. Instead of owning shares in the person companies that make up the fund, investors purchase shares in the fund, which depict their ownership. Plus the investors share while in the fund’s revenue and losses.
